Description

Stay current with the rapid advancements in medical research through The Handbook of Biomarkers, Second Edition. Published by Humana and authored by Prof. Kewal K. Jain, this updated text addresses the massive changes in biomarker discovery and application since the first edition. This resource is essential for researchers working across nearly every therapeutic area, with a specific focus on cancer research. The second edition provides a full revision to ensure you have access to the most recent developments in the field. It offers detailed descriptions of various biomarker types and explores how they are identified using modern -omics technologies. Beyond discovery, this handbook provides the necessary background information required to evaluate biomarkers effectively. It serves as a comprehensive guide for those needing to understand both the technical processes of discovery and the practical requirements for evaluation in a clinical or research setting. Whether you are studying oncology or other therapeutic disciplines, this book provides the foundational knowledge needed to navigate the evolving landscape of biomarker science.
